1. Venture Far Off the Beaten Path
The opportunities for exploration are endless when you’re driving the Bronco, which offers up to seven different driving modes that help you tackle just about any type of driving condition you might encounter, including sand and snow, mud, and rocks. This SUV also has trail-friendly features like 11.6-inch ground clearance, water fording capability, and available steel bash plates that protect the Bronco’s underside.
Available High-Performance Off-Road Stability Suspension Systems allow you to tackle uneven terrain confidently. Grab handles on the center console and both corners of the dash make it easy to climb in and out, even if the vehicle is on a steep angle. Water bottles, flashlights, and other gear can be securely stowed using the Integrated MOLLE Panel System.
2. Open-Air Adventure
Thanks to removable doors and tops, the Bronco makes it easy to open things up and let nature in. Choose from the Bronco’s traditional square shape with two extra-long doors that allow rear access or the family-friendly four-door configuration. The doors can be stowed in the cargo area when not in use.
The Bronco’s Soft Top can be set up in a range of configurations, and the interior of the Bronco is durable and easy to maintain. Several available accessories, including a classic mesh soft top, tube doors, and roof rails with crossbars, help you get the most out of every adventure. There’s even an available rooftop tent.
3. Safety on the Road
Built for adventure, the Bronco is also equipped with plenty of features that offer peace of mind while you’re out exploring. A rear view camera with backup assist grid lines, automatic high-beam headlamps, and an Individual Tire Pressure Monitoring System all come standard.
